Google Pixel Fold is coming in Q1 2023, Console shipments will start in January


The Google Pixel Fold launch schedule has been revealed online, ahead of the launch of Google’s Pixel-branded foldable phone. The news comes shortly after the launch of the Pixel 7 series earlier this week, along with the company’s first smartwatch, the Pixel Watch. While enthusiasts were hoping to see Google’s foldable smartphone at the Made by Google launch event, the company is said to have delayed the launch of this foldable phone. . According to Ross Young CEO of Display Supply Chain Consulting (DSCC), the first foldable Pixel phone could launch in Q1 of 2023.

Reply one tweet by tip Roland Quandt (@rquandt) when asked about the Pixel foldable phone, Young said that GoogleHis first foldable phone could be out in Q1 of 2023. He also claim that the company will start accepting panel shipments for the handset in January.

Before report hints that Google may be working on two foldable smartphones. Recently, a developer discovered mention of a foldable smartphone codenamed ‘Felix’ in a line of code from Google’s Android 13 Quarterly Platform Release 1 (QPR1) beta.

The foldable phone is said to feature a triple rear camera setup, consisting of an IMX787 main sensor, an IMX386 ultra-wide-angle lens, and an S5K3J1 telephoto lens. Its external display will likely feature the S5k3J1 telephoto selfie camera. Earlier this year, a Google foldable phone codenamed ‘Pipit’ was also released rise. The developer claims that the Tensor SoC included in this model is now obsolete.

Recently report suggests that Google’s foldable smartphone could be named Pixel Fold or Pixel Notepad. It is said to be manufactured by Foxconn in China. The launch of this smartphone is reported was delayed earlier this year in May. It will likely have a 7.57-inch inner screen and a 5.78-inch outer display with an ultra-thin glass cover.
